stalker.models.ticket.TicketLog¶
-
class
stalker.models.ticket.TicketLog(ticket=None, from_status=None, to_status=None, action=None, **kwargs)[source]¶ Bases:
stalker.models.entity.SimpleEntityHolds
Ticket.Ticket.statuschange operations.Parameters: - ticket (
Ticket) – An instance ofTicketwhich the subject to the operation. - from_status – Holds a reference to a
Statusinstance which is the previous status of theTicket. - to_status – Holds a reference to a
Statusinstance which is the new status of the :class;`.Ticket`. - operation –
An Enumerator holding the type of the operation. Possible values are: RESOLVE or REOPEN
Operations follow the Track Workflow,

-
__init__(ticket=None, from_status=None, to_status=None, action=None, **kwargs)¶
Methods
__init__([ticket, from_status, to_status, …])Attributes
actioncreated_byThe Userwho has created this object.created_by_idThe id of the Userwho has created this entity.date_createdA datetime.datetimeinstance showing the creation date and time of this object.date_updatedA datetime.datetimeinstance showing the update date and time of this object.descriptionDescription of this object. entity_groupsentity_typefrom_statusfrom_status_idgeneric_dataThis attribute can hold any kind of data which exists in SOM. generic_textThis attribute can hold any text. html_classhtml_styleidmetadatanameName of this object nice_nameNice name of this object. plural_class_namethe plural name of this class querythumbnailthumbnail_idticketticket_idticket_log_idtjp_idreturns TaskJuggler compatible id to_statusto_status_idto_tjprenders a TaskJuggler compliant string used for TaskJuggler typeThe type of the object. type_idThe id of the Typeof this entity.updated_byThe Userwho has updated this object.updated_by_idThe id of the Userwho has updated this entity.-
date_created¶ A
datetime.datetimeinstance showing the creation date and time of this object.
-
date_updated¶ A
datetime.datetimeinstance showing the update date and time of this object.
-
description¶ Description of this object.
-
generic_data¶ This attribute can hold any kind of data which exists in SOM.
-
generic_text¶ This attribute can hold any text.
-
name¶ Name of this object
-
nice_name¶ Nice name of this object.
It has the same value with the name (contextually) but with a different format like, all the white spaces replaced by underscores (“_”), all the CamelCase form will be expanded by underscore (_) characters and it is always lower case.
-
plural_class_name¶ the plural name of this class
-
tjp_id¶ returns TaskJuggler compatible id
-
to_tjp¶ renders a TaskJuggler compliant string used for TaskJuggler integration. Needs to be overridden in inherited classes.
-
type¶ The type of the object.
It is a
Typeinstance with a properType.target_entity_type.
- ticket (